WMS Implementation Consultant
US East, US West, or Distributed-US
We exist to transform our customers and change lives.
Who We're Looking For:
The Warehouse implementation consultant will be responsible for the design, configuration, testing and supporting the full implementation of the RF-SMART data collection software application for the NetSuite ERP system. With a broad understanding of general warehouse operations, best practices and business processes, the consultant will lead the implementation effort directly for our customers.
What You'll Do:
• Deliver detailed warehouse data collection solutions using RF-SMART for NetSuite ERP application
• Areas of concentration: receiving, inventory control, picking and light production
• Lead/perform all implementation tasks and assist customer with application design, setup, testing and training
• Advise customers on best practices in the areas of warehouse setup, receiving and shipping
• Be the main point of contact throughout the implementation
• Work effectively with staff members and executives at all levels within customer organizations
• Assume role of Trusted Advisor to customers and be comfortable as primary contact to provide product information and best practice solutions
• Communicate suggested enhancements to development team
What You Bring:
• Bachelor degree in supply chain related discipline is preferred or equivalent experience; other business management disciplines considered
• 5+ years of warehouse operational experience with one or more companies or warehouse consulting for a software company
• Working knowledge of an ERP supply chain or warehouse management software solution
• Strong communication with executives and partners (executive level visibility)
• Ability to translate complex topics into operation impact
• Experience with NetSuite would be an advantage
• Ability to anticipate risks rather than react to them
• Ability to push forward when decisions stall
• Comfortable in a focused, high-ownership delivery model.
• Ability to quickly establish themselves as a trusted advisor
• Good written and verbal communication skills
• Excellent presentation skills
• Willingness to travel more than 30% (current expected amount for each consultant)
• Self-motivated with ability to work on multiple projects independently
